The Taparia ECN06 Pincer 160mm is a straightforward, nononsense hand tool thats built for grabbing, cutting and pulling stuff that wont quit wires, nails, pins you name it, itll take a swing at it with dignity.
If youve ever wrestled with stubborn wire or had to yank out a stubborn nail in a cramped corner, the 160mm pincer with hardened jaws gives you the control and leverage you need without fuss and without breaking your grip midjob.
Key Features:
- Forged Carbon Steel Construction – gives the tool the muscle to handle firm metal without deforming under pressure.
- Hardened Cutting Jaws – stays sharp through repeated cuts of soft and hard wire alike.
- Compact 160mm Size – fits in a belt pouch, yet still delivers decent bite force.
- Ergonomic Grip Handles – cuts down on hand fatigue when youre pulling a string of nails.
- Polished Finish – sheds grime and stands up to workshop grime.

Technical Specifications Explained
- Overall Length: 160mm – compact size for tight spots but with enough arm to give leverage.
- Carbon Steel Material – traditional, dependable metal that doesnt twiddle under load.
- HRC 4548 Body Hardness – the main structure resists buckling under torque.
- Induction Hardened Cutting Edge HRC 5560 – cutting edges that stay sharp longer on frequent use.
- PVC Grip Handle – comfort and slip resistance for sweaty palms or greasy gloves.
